Output 97860384bb7007158fd5cd862e8f4c1535b31dcb282287df81108720c77ae8a8:0

value
1520752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ce707e1bd0979021bab32f3db305da8a55eda27 OP_EQUAL
address
3BcqfZYtvFMaY2qQhxa1L7U8xDkAAo6j1T
transaction
97860384bb7007158fd5cd862e8f4c1535b31dcb282287df81108720c77ae8a8
spent
true